The Washington Commanders National Football League team has selected a joint venture of Clark Construction Group, Mortenson and Smoot Construction Co. to lead construction of its new 65,000-seat stadium. 

Located on the site of the now-demolished RFK Stadium on the banks of the Anacostia River in Washington, D.C., the estimated $3.8-billion HKS-designed facility is the centerpiece of a multi-phase redevelopment plan for the surrounding 180-acre campus, including housing, parks and recreation, hotels, restaurants, retail and neighborhood amenities.

Enabling work has been underway since June on the 1.8-million-sq-ft stadium, with full construction set to begin in the spring of 2027. Along with serving as the Commanders’ home field beginning with the 2030 season, the enclosed, climate-controlled facility will have the ability to host a broad range of events each year. Sustainability, advanced technology and an immersive fan experience will be at the forefront of the stadium’s design, according to a team announcement.

The joint venture brings a wealth of collective experience building complex high-profile sports and entertainment venues, including local landmarks such as Nationals Park and Capital One Arena, as well as NFL stadiums in other cities. 

Clark is also the lead contractor for the White House Ballroom project, which is currently paused pending the outcome of litigation over the controversial project.

The stadium design is in the final stages of its federal review process, following the Commanders’ presentation to the U.S. Commission of Fine Arts on July 16. Commission members welcomed design changes requested at its April meeting, including the addition of a new west-side balcony that will offer views of both the U.S. Capitol and the Washington Monument. Although refinements were also made to the stadium’s east and west entrances, the commission requested further work on those areas in advance of its final vote on the project, now scheduled for mid-September.
